Cambuí: Missing father and son found dead in vehicle crash

A father and son who had been missing for three days were found dead inside a vehicle in a ravine along the BR-381 highway in Cambuí, Minas Gerais. The victims were identified as 58-year-old Hélio da Silva Eduardo and 29-year-old Michael Jefferson Gomes Ribeiro.

The two men had departed from Ribeirão das Neves on Tuesday, September 15, traveling toward Guarulhos, São Paulo, for work-related purposes. They were last seen during the early hours of Wednesday, September 16, before failing to respond to family communications.

The vehicle, a white Volkswagen Saveiro, was discovered on Friday morning by teams from the Motiva concessionaire. According to the Military Firefighters Corps (CBMMG), the car appears to have left the roadway, crossed a fence, and fallen into a ravine following a curve. Family members expressed distress that they were the ones to discover the bodies and noted that no security agencies had been alerted to the accident.
